How many miles does a 2008 Chrysler Pacifica last?
The Chrysler Pacifica can last between 200,000 and 250,000 miles on average with proper maintenance and conservative driving habits. Based on driving 15,000 miles per year, a Pacifica is expected to last 13 to 17 years before repair costs become uneconomical or the vehicle breaks down.

Does Pacifica Touring L have power sliding doors?
The Touring starts with LED exterior lighting, a power liftgate, power sliding side doors, and heated side mirrors. Moving up to the Touring L will have second- and third-row window shades, while the Limited adds power-folding mirrors, hands-free power-sliding doors, and a liftgate.

Why was the Pacifica discontinued?
The Pacifica only saw five model years of production before it was discontinued because nobody was buying it. Chrysler ambitiously planned on selling more than 100,000 Pacificas per year and actually came pretty close to that number in 2004, but there was a sharp decline in sales after that.
